damage

ok, first off i screwed up.... i took a turn too fast the other day, while in a storm, my front left tire blew up and i lost control of the car, i jumped a curve and hit a stop sing. i know i suck, but i honestly tried everything to avoid this accident. i have minor damage to the bumper (needs a spray) but what i am worried about is other things...can this have broken the new clutch i had installed a week ago? cause now when the car decelarates in gear it makes a noise, like a sort of spinning sound...this sound is present in all manual cars but it seems a bit louder now...could i have also screwed up my allignment? or worse? if anyone can tell me anything it would help...i will bring it in to check it out but i at least want an idea of what im up againts...

Re: damage

it's cool. As long as you are okay, that is the important thing.

Does it feel like the clutch is slipping at all? heres a test. Start the car. Put it in first gear with the clutch pedal all the way down to the floor. With your foot on the brake, slowly let the clutch up. If the car continues to run without stalling, then the clutch is bad. did you check under the car, maybe some plastic skirting or something came loose and is rubbing on a CV joint, or on a tire.

really though, it could be a hundred things. The only real way to tell, is to take it in. As soon as possible. It coud be the throw-out bearing in the clutch or something.
